Output 56f8645267d31c28ca22ac71556c433b6116d0753fa81f79d2d6dd85afad181e:13

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 3f41ff7d1fd65cf67f69b855b65f4f857e083e87
address
tb1q8aql7lgl6ew0vlmfhp2mvh60s4lqs058md7mmd
transaction
56f8645267d31c28ca22ac71556c433b6116d0753fa81f79d2d6dd85afad181e
confirmations
64942
spent
true